Pinoy Independent Film ‘Confessional’ Wins Filmfest Award in India
Kudos to Filipino independent film makers Jerrold Tarog and Ruel Antipuesto. Their movie “Confessional” won the Best Film in the category of First Features at the 10th Osian’s Festival of Asian and Arab Cinema in New Delhi on July 19, 2008.
